Ticket VLT-889: Vault locked during stale-cache postmortem

While compiling the postmortem for the Renner stale-cache incident, I attempted to pull the audit bundle from the Coldgate vault and found it sealed after three failed unlock attempts by an earlier responder. The bundle is required to verify cache-invalidation timestamps in the report. Security review has approved a supervised unseal. Per Coldgate procedure, the supervised unseal requires the recovery passphrase recorded below.

vault phrase of bagaf-kajeg = jorath-feniel-briir-siliel-ralix

## Driver assignment acting weird?

Welcome aboard! If Fernhop's dispatcher keeps assigning the same two drivers, it's usually the heuristic's recency penalty being zeroed out by a stale cache. Flush the assignment cache, then re-run the scorer with `--verbose` to see the per-driver weights. Nine times out of ten that fixes it. To pull live assignment logs from the staging dispatcher, authenticate with the token below.

portal login ticket: eyJhbGciOiJIUzI1NiIsInR5cCI6IkpXVCJ9.eyJzdWIiOiI0Z4ywpUMsBIn0.ca5FVhkdBXa3

Runbook: account recovery — Tracewend tracing platform. If the on-call service account is locked out, trace spans stop flowing across all Vellamont microservices within minutes. Do not restart collectors first. Instead: confirm lockout in the admin panel, then trigger the break-glass recovery flow from the bastion host. The flow prompts for the standing recovery passphrase, noted below.

strongbox words: gilok-druion-briath-wendor-briion-prawyn-fenion-oliir-casdor-holius-briius-gilath-gilael-pelys

**Ticket #4417 — AddressPilot autocomplete drops unit numbers**

Severity: Medium. Component: AddressPilot widget v3.

Users report the suggestion list strips apartment/unit numbers when a street match is selected. Repro: type a full address with "Unit 4", pick the top suggestion, unit field clears. Affects checkout flows at Marwick Outfitters and two other tenants. Workaround: manual entry after selection. Does not occur on v2 widget. Fix targeted for next sprint. Attach logs from affected sessions. The affected build token follows.

build token for kagaf-hahof: htk14_9d3d4d26d7d8de